Lines Matching defs:setup
318 struct p54_setup_mac *setup;
321 skb = p54_alloc_skb(priv, P54_HDR_FLAG_CONTROL_OPSET, sizeof(*setup),
326 setup = skb_put(skb, sizeof(*setup));
358 setup->mac_mode = cpu_to_le16(mode);
359 memcpy(setup->mac_addr, priv->mac_addr, ETH_ALEN);
360 memcpy(setup->bssid, priv->bssid, ETH_ALEN);
361 setup->rx_antenna = 2 & priv->rx_diversity_mask; /* automatic */
362 setup->rx_align = 0;
364 setup->v1.basic_rate_mask = cpu_to_le32(priv->basic_rate_mask);
365 memset(setup->v1.rts_rates, 0, 8);
366 setup->v1.rx_addr = cpu_to_le32(priv->rx_end);
367 setup->v1.max_rx = cpu_to_le16(priv->rx_mtu);
368 setup->v1.rxhw = cpu_to_le16(priv->rxhw);
369 setup->v1.wakeup_timer = cpu_to_le16(priv->wakeup_timer);
370 setup->v1.unalloc0 = cpu_to_le16(0);
372 setup->v2.rx_addr = cpu_to_le32(priv->rx_end);
373 setup->v2.max_rx = cpu_to_le16(priv->rx_mtu);
374 setup->v2.rxhw = cpu_to_le16(priv->rxhw);
375 setup->v2.timer = cpu_to_le16(priv->wakeup_timer);
376 setup->v2.truncate = cpu_to_le16(48896);
377 setup->v2.basic_rate_mask = cpu_to_le32(priv->basic_rate_mask);
378 setup->v2.sbss_offset = 0;
379 setup->v2.mcast_window = 0;
380 setup->v2.rx_rssi_threshold = 0;
381 setup->v2.rx_ed_threshold = 0;
382 setup->v2.ref_clock = cpu_to_le32(644245094);
383 setup->v2.lpf_bandwidth = cpu_to_le16(65535);
384 setup->v2.osc_start_delay = cpu_to_le16(65535);